Transaction e42e6789fda7a3100cdd8e27370e7bd5d8e33e755ebca33544bd6a782d5f3f89
1 Input
1 Output
-
e42e6789fda7a3100cdd8e27370e7bd5d8e33e755ebca33544bd6a782d5f3f89:0
- value
- 26819544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 822f2a429ddef277314b080bbd91ecdf6e011e4f OP_EQUAL
- address
- MKmWaTMpdpRhxjQkCCWv7E3q8B5xV5JUAB